Sat 797519532527188

decimal
159503.4532527188
degree
0°159503′239″4532527188‴
percentile
37.97712063830762%
name
iewcfipmfuz
cycle
0
epoch
0
period
79
block
159503
offset
4532527188
timestamp
rarity
common
inscriptions
location
948e765e949f0cf6b48d036ee35a7f8d1dd6909def4f3c60e77e3b0e9ddc93f2:413:0
address
bc1pxeaq2vzr9mq9j6822thdjt8zl07c005lmdspw2kv233rjfg0qgps2pw888